EVERTON PARK RESULTS FROM 16TH March 2008
Mark Moran – Again looked a class act in winning every round and now moves onto an English Title fight against Danny Wallace on the 28th March.
Carl Dilks – A good effort by Dilcs pushing forward at every opportunity, but never really looking like stopping the durable Walker .Carl sank in a left hook to the body in the 6th which took the wind from the sails , but Dean managed to hang in there.
Martin Murray - Another solid if not spectacular performance by Murray who forced the fight for every minute , but his eagerness for a KO smothered a lot of his work and the Polish guy - who took some good shots - was never in any real danger of folding .
Paul Kier – Looked composed on his pro debut and gave warhorse Paul Bonson plenty to think about.
Brett Flourney , John Watson and Joe Mc Nally - All boxed as home time guests on the VIP show and put in winning performances.
COLNE 30TH MARCH – Chris Johnson has pulled out with a perforated ear drum and a replacement will be announced shortly to join the VIP fighters Jack Arnfield , Stuart McFadgen , Shaun Horsfeild and Tommy McDonough on the bill which will be confirmed very soon.

Channel M -Filmed the above Everton event and it will be shown at 7pm on the 5th and 6th April 2008 . The Colne show will be shown on the 12th and 13th April with the George Carnell event going out on the 10th and 11th May.
